XAYSOMBOUN OVERVIEW
Located: about 230 kilometers north of the Vientiane Capital (Central Provinces)
Total area: 8,300 square kilometers
Population: 82,000 
5 Districts: Anouvong, Long Cheng, Tha Thom, Long San & Hom
Capital of the province: Anouvong.


Xaysomboun Province was established on 13 December, 2013 as is the 18th Province of Laos. It is located in the central part of Laos, bordering Xieng Khouang Province to the north and the east, Bolikhamxay Province to the south and Vientiane Province to the west. The Province consists of 5 districts which include Anouvong, Long Cheng, Long San, Hom and Tha Thom District. The total population is around 80,000 with Hmong the majority of its people. This province does not share any borders with neighboring countries.

Xaysomboun Province has abundant natural resources scattered in high mountains and steep valleys. Due to this contour, the climate in Xaysomboun is pretty cool with the annual average temperature of approximately 20˚C. Furthermore, this province has rich culture and tradition coupled with generous hospitality of local people.
